Have you ever heard that your weapons of warfare are not carnal, but mighty through God to the pulling down of strongholds? Well, it’s true. Second Corinthians 10:4 tells us so. Listen sis. As you press to live right and do what God has called you to do, guess what? You will experience spiritual warfare and you will face things in your life that will like you have no control over…but that’s when you have to learn to let God fight the battle for you.

In this life, opposition will come. Tough circumstances will pop up without much notice. And people will come against you or do things that will just completely shock you! However, when these things happen, know that you are not alone in the process. God is your very present help in a time of trouble, your mighty deliverer, and your vindicator! So let Him help you, deliver you in His perfect timing, and be your vindicator/defender. The more you realize this, the more you’ll begin to let go and NOT take matters into your own hands. Instead, you can KNOW that the battle belongs to the Lord!

He reassures us of this in 2 Chronicles 20:12 & 15 stating, “Do not be afraid! Don’t be discouraged by this mighty army, for the battle is not yours, but God’s.” Amen!
